Education
After completing his undergraduate studies at the University of Natal, Nicholas Roland Leybourne Haysom earned his Bachelor of Laws from the University of Cape Town in 1978. During this formative period, he served as the president of the National Union of South African Students, a role that placed him at the forefront of student resistance against the apartheid regime. His academic achievements were inextricably linked to his burgeoning reputation as a human rights defender, leading him to join the Centre for Applied Legal Studies where he specialized in labor law and cases involving police violence. This legal foundation proved essential for his future work in dismantling institutionalized racism through the South African court system.
